Description

Primary Objective: Phase 1b: - To determine the recommended phase 2 dose (RP2D) of intratumoral SD 101 in combination with ibrutinib and radiation in subjects with rel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ma . - To determine the safety and tolerability of SD 101 in combination with ibrutinib and radiation in subjects with rel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ma Phase 2: -To evaluate the efficacy of intratumoral SD 101 in combination with ibrutinib and radiation in subjects with rel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ma by assessing overall response rate Secondary Objective: Phase 2: - To evaluate progression free survival after treatment with intratumoral SD 101 in combination with ibrutinib and radiation in subjects with rel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ma - To evaluate the induction of tumor-specific immune responses by treatment with intratumoral SD-101 in combination with ibrutinib and radiation in patients with relapsed or refractory B cell lymphoma
